The Wellington Hospital is currently recruiting for a Senior Staff Nurse to join the Urgent Care Centre team!
As a Senior Staff Nurse at our Urgent Care Centre, you will be providing high quality nursing through assessing, planning, delivering and evaluating care for patients within the Urgent Care. The successful candidate will also promote a progressive attitude to the continual improvement of patient care and the services offered within the Urgent Care Centre.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Demonstrate good clinical practice at all times and be accountable for own actions
- Triage patients according to clinical need and acuity
- Prioritise workloads and direct staff accordingly
- Make efficient use of available resources
- Regularly deputise for the charge nurse, providing management and leadership in their absence
- Promote team working
- Assess, plan and deliver care, based on individual patient and family needs
- Carry out Point of Care Testing duties in accordance with POCT policy
What you will bring:
- Registered Nurse Level 1
- NMC Registration and PREP requirements
- Previous experience working in emergency nursing
- Triage Skills
- Recognised post graduate emergency nursing course
- Phlebotomy training essential
- Recognised course in plastering techniques desirable
- Advanced Life Support Course desirable (must have a willingness to undertake if does not hold course)
- Knowledge of relevant hospital policies and procedures
- Health and Safety training
- Lifting and Handling
